LISA COOK INTELLIGENCE DOSSIER

Lisa Cook is a Federal Reserve governor and monetary policy expert whose influence centers on US economic governance during a period of significant institutional tension. As a current member of the Federal Reserve Board of Governors, Cook shapes monetary policy decisions affecting global financial markets and represents the institutional continuity of the Fed's independence doctrine. Her strategic significance lies in her positioning as a potential swing voice within Fed deliberations as the Trump administration actively pursues unprecedented personnel changes at the central bank, making her survival or departure a critical indicator of Fed autonomy versus executive pressure.
